The Core Composition of Colostrum Powder

At its heart, colostrum powder is simply dried bovine colostrum, the first milk from cows after calving. The supplement industry processes this liquid gold by pasteurizing it at low temperatures to preserve its delicate bioactive compounds, before dehydrating it into a fine powder. This process concentrates all the beneficial components found in the original substance, which are present in much higher concentrations than in mature milk. The resulting powder is a complex matrix of nutrients and potent biological molecules, broadly categorized into macronutrients, immune factors, and growth factors.

Key Immune Factors (Bioactive Compounds)

The most celebrated components of colostrum powder are its immunological factors, which are critical for providing passive immunity to a newborn calf and are thought to offer benefits to humans as well. These include:

  • Immunoglobulins (Antibodies): These are perhaps the most well-known ingredient. The primary immunoglobulins found in bovine colostrum are IgG, IgA, and IgM. In bovine colostrum, IgG is particularly dominant, accounting for the bulk of its antibody content. These antibodies are designed to recognize and neutralize specific pathogens like bacteria and viruses.
  • Lactoferrin: A versatile protein with strong antimicrobial and anti-inflammatory properties. Lactoferrin works by binding to iron, which many harmful bacteria need to grow, making it an effective line of defense. It also plays a role in regulating the immune response.
  • Cytokines: These small messenger proteins are crucial for communication between immune cells, helping to coordinate and regulate the body's immune response to inflammation, infection, and injury.
  • Proline-Rich Polypeptides (PRPs): Acting as signal-transducing molecules, PRPs help to modulate the immune system, either stimulating it when needed or dampening it down in cases of overactivity.
  • Lysozyme and Lactoperoxidase: These are enzymes that possess potent antibacterial activity, aiding in the breakdown and destruction of harmful bacteria.

Essential Growth Factors

Beyond immune support, the growth factors present in colostrum powder are vital for stimulating growth and healing processes. These peptides are central to tissue repair and the development of a healthy gastrointestinal tract. Notable growth factors include:

  • Insulin-like Growth Factors (IGF-1 and IGF-2): These hormones are powerful stimulants for growth and regeneration, promoting muscle repair and the maintenance of intestinal tissues.
  • Transforming Growth Factors (TGF-α and TGF-β): Involved in cell growth, differentiation, and tissue repair, these factors play a significant role in promoting wound healing and maintaining gut health.
  • Epidermal Growth Factor (EGF): This factor is particularly important for stimulating the growth of intestinal cells and maintaining the integrity of the gut wall.

Nutritional Macronutrients and Micronutrients

Colostrum powder is also a highly concentrated source of general nutrition, providing a rich blend of proteins, vitamins, and minerals that surpass the levels found in regular milk.

  • Proteins and Amino Acids: As a powdered protein supplement, it provides a high percentage of protein. This includes a wide array of essential and non-essential amino acids necessary for tissue building and repair.
  • Vitamins: It contains a spectrum of fat-soluble and water-soluble vitamins, including significant levels of Vitamins A, E, C, and various B vitamins like B6 and B12.
  • Minerals: A dense source of important minerals, colostrum powder is rich in calcium, phosphorus, magnesium, zinc, and iron.
  • Fats and Carbohydrates: While generally processed to be lower in fat and lactose than raw colostrum, the powder still contains these macronutrients. Whole colostrum powder contains more fat, while skimmed versions are lower.

The Importance of Processing and Quality

The ingredient list for colostrum powder might seem simple, but the manufacturing process is critical. High-quality products should be derived from bovine colostrum collected within the first few days after calving to ensure the highest concentration of bioactives, especially IgG. Reputable manufacturers utilize low-heat pasteurization and gentle drying techniques to preserve the integrity and functionality of sensitive components like immunoglobulins and growth factors. Purity is also a key factor, with many high-end brands opting for products that are free from antibiotics, hormones, and pesticides. It's crucial for consumers to check for third-party testing and certifications to ensure both the quality and absence of contaminants. Colostrum Powder vs. Mature Milk Powder: A Comparison

Feature Colostrum Powder (Bovine) Mature Milk Powder (Bovine)
Immunoglobulin (IgG) Content Very High (Often >15%) Very Low (<1%)
Lactoferrin Content High (1.5-5 g/L) Low (0.02-0.75 g/L)
Growth Factors (e.g., IGF-1) High (50-2000 µg/L) Very Low (<10 µg/L)
Protein Content Very High (50%+ for high-protein versions) Moderate (around 30-35% for skim milk powder)
Lactose Content Lower than mature milk High
Primary Function Immune support, gut health, tissue repair General nutrition, protein source
